Question
Find the area and perimeter of the circles with following: Diameter = 77cm

Solution
The radius of a Circle with diameter d is r = `"d"/(2)`
The Area of a Circle with radius r = πr2
The radius of a Circle with diameter 77 is r
= `(77)/(2)`
= 38.5cm
The Area of a Circle with radius r
= π(38.5)2
= `(22)/(7) xx (38.5)^2`
= 4658.5cm2
The Circumference of a Circle with diameter d is πd
The Circumference of a Circle with diameter 77 is π x 77
= `(22)/(7) xx 77`
= 242cm.
